Risk-Based Inspection (RBI)
API 580/581 compliant RBI assessments for pressure vessels, piping, heat exchangers, and process equipment — prioritizing inspection resources based on probability and consequence of failure.
- —Damage mechanism identification and PoF assessment
- —Consequence of failure evaluation
- —Inspection effectiveness analysis
- —Risk ranking and interval optimization
- —Inspection method and scope selection
- —RBI program evergreening and update
Corrosion Management
Structured corrosion management programs covering external, internal, and under-insulation corrosion threats across process piping, pressure equipment, and pipeline systems.
- —Corrosion circuit review and CML optimization
- —Damage mechanism screening and review
- —Corrosion rate assessment and trending
- —Injection point and dead leg inspection programs
- —Integrity Operating Window (IOW) development
- —Corrosion monitoring strategy
Advanced Non-Destructive Testing
Specialist PAUT, TOFD, LRUT, digital radiography, and conventional NDT services with engineering interpretation connected to RBI, FFS, and integrity management decisions.
- —Phased Array UT (PAUT) and TOFD inspection
- —Long-Range UT (LRUT / Guided Wave UT) screening
- —Digital radiography — CUI profile and weld assessment
- —Pulsed Eddy Current (PEC) screening
- —Corrosion mapping and wall loss profiling
- —NDT program development and interpretation
CUI Integrity Management
End-to-end Corrosion Under Insulation integrity management — from insulated asset registers and risk screening through advanced NDT inspection planning, field verification, and program documentation.
- —CUI susceptibility assessment and risk ranking
- —Location-driven inspection strategy
- —Digital radiography and PEC inspection planning
- —CUI integrity manual development
- —Risk tool and data management support
- —API RP 583 aligned program documentation
PSV Integrity Management
Risk-based inspection program development for pressure safety valves — moving from fixed-interval testing to defensible risk-informed inspection intervals and reliability tracking.
- —PSV inventory and data management
- —Risk ranking and interval justification
- —As-found/as-left performance data analysis
- —Regulatory alignment — ABSA AB-505/AB-506
- —PSV program audit and improvement
- —API RP 576 aligned inspection planning
